在当今数字化时代,构建高性能、稳定可靠的服务器环境对于企业至关重要,作为全球领先的云计算服务提供商之一,阿里云为用户提供了一系列强大的工具和资源,其中阿里云服务器(ECS)结合Internet Information Services(IIS)服务器,能够满足各种Web应用的需求。
准备工作:选择合适的阿里云服务器配置
-
评估需求:
- 确定所需的CPU核心数、内存大小以及存储空间。
- 根据预估的用户访问量选择适当的服务器规格。
-
创建实例:
图片来源于网络,如有侵权联系删除
- 登录阿里云控制台,进入ECS管理页面。
- 选择适合您的硬件配置和操作系统类型(如Windows Server或Linux)。
- 点击“购买”按钮完成订单流程。
-
初始化服务器:
- 购买完成后,您将收到邮件通知,包含登录信息和初始密码。
- 使用提供的凭证通过远程桌面连接到您的服务器。
安装IIS服务器软件
-
下载IIS安装包:
- 打开浏览器,导航至Microsoft官方网站下载最新版本的IIS安装程序。
-
执行安装过程:
- 双击下载后的exe文件开始安装。
- 按照提示逐步进行操作,包括接受许可协议等步骤。
-
配置基本设置:
- 安装完成后,打开IIS管理器(inetmgr.msc)。
- 右键点击网站项,选择“属性”,然后转到“主目录”标签页。
- 在“本地路径”字段中输入您的站点根目录路径。
-
添加必要的扩展名支持:
- 在IIS管理器的左侧面板中选择“HTTP头”,右键单击空白处并选择“新建→映射”。
- 填写映射名称和扩展名,.html”,并将处理程序设置为相应的应用程序池。
-
安全考虑:
- 确保“身份验证”选项设置为“匿名访问”或其他所需模式。
- 配置SSL证书以保护数据传输的安全性。
部署Web应用
-
准备项目文件:
将您的Web应用程序文件夹复制到服务器的指定位置(如C:\inetpub\wwwroot)。
-
修改默认文档:
- 在IIS管理器中找到对应的网站,展开“网站”节点下的“主目录”。
- 右键单击“默认文档”,选择“编辑列表”,添加或删除默认显示的网页文件。
-
测试网站运行情况:
- 访问http://
或 来检查是否成功部署了您的网站。 - 如果一切正常,恭喜您已经完成了基本的IIS服务器搭建工作!
- 访问http://
优化性能与安全性
-
监控服务器状态:
- 利用阿里云监控中心实时监测CPU使用率、内存占用等关键指标。
- 定期备份重要数据和配置文件以防万一。
-
实施负载均衡策略:
- 当单台服务器无法承受高并发请求时,可以考虑启用多台服务器并进行负载均衡分配流量。
- 可以借助阿里云的SLB(Server Load Balancer)实现自动分发请求。
-
定期更新补丁:
及时安装系统及应用的最新安全更新和修复漏洞,保障系统的稳定性与安全性。
-
数据备份与管理:
采用RAID技术提高数据的可靠性;同时利用阿里云对象存储OSS等服务进行异地容灾和数据恢复。
-
优化网络带宽:
图片来源于网络,如有侵权联系删除
根据实际业务需求合理规划带宽资源,避免因过载导致的网络瓶颈问题。
-
防火墙规则调整:
根据需要自定义防火墙规则,限制不必要的端口开放,增强网络安全防护能力。
-
日志分析与审计:
通过阿里云日志服务收集和分析服务器日志信息,及时发现潜在的安全威胁和异常行为。
-
自动化运维实践:
推荐使用Ansible、Puppet等自动化工具简化日常运维管理工作,提升工作效率。
-
持续集成与交付(CI/CD):
实现代码仓库到生产环境的无缝衔接,确保每次发布的质量和速度都达到最佳水平。
-
故障排查与应急响应:
制定详细的应急预案,明确各环节责任人及其职责分工,确保快速有效应对突发事件。
-
合规性审查:
遵守相关法律法规和政策要求,确保所有操作符合国家规定和国际标准。
-
用户体验优化:
关注用户反馈意见并及时改进产品功能和服务质量,不断提升客户满意度。
-
成本效益分析:
标签: #阿里云服务器iis设置
评论列表